Ha Nguyen McNeill Career

Ha Nguyen McNeill began her career in U.S. government service, focusing on policy development related to trade, security, and international affairs. Her early roles involved working within the Department of Homeland Security (DHS), where she gained foundational experience in national security operations. 

She quickly advanced into more strategic roles, serving in the Office of Management and Budget and other federal agencies, where she contributed to policy coordination and security initiatives. Her expertise in trade security, intellectual property, and supply chain protection helped establish her reputation. 

During this stage, she also completed two tours at the White House, including roles in the Office of the Intellectual Property Enforcement Coordinator and the National Security Council, where she served as Director of Aviation Security. 

Her major breakthrough came with her leadership role at the Transportation Security Administration (TSA), where she served as Chief of Staff from 2017 to 2019. In this position, she played a key role in modernizing airport security systems and implementing advanced technologies. 

She helped introduce innovations such as improved screening technologies and public-private partnerships, strengthening TSA’s operational capabilities.

After her initial tenure at TSA, she transitioned into the private sector, where she held executive roles, including Chief Operating Officer at BSA and leadership positions in AI and digital identity solutions at BigBear.ai. 

These roles allowed her to gain experience in technology, innovation, and global operations, further strengthening her leadership profile.

In April 2026, she was appointed Deputy Administrator of TSA and later became the Acting Administrator, taking charge of the agency’s operations. 

As of 2026, she leads efforts to address staffing shortages, funding challenges, and increasing security demands, particularly in preparation for major international events.

TSA Funding Crisis and Congressional Testimony (2026)

In 2026, Ha Nguyen McNeill gained national attention for her leadership during a critical funding and staffing crisis at the TSA.

She testified before the U.S. House Committee on Homeland Security, warning of a “perfect storm” involving record passenger volumes, workforce shortages, and funding instability. 

The agency faced operational challenges due to federal funding lapses, which affected employee morale, staffing levels, and long-term planning. 

She emphasized the urgency of addressing these issues, especially with the United States preparing to host the 2026 FIFA World Cup, which is expected to significantly increase international travel.
